BUS bosses were left beaming after picking up two awards this week.
Go South Coast, which owns Swindon-based Thamesdown Transport, was named Large Bus Company of the Year at the prestigious RouteOne Bus Awards.
Judges praised the company's customer services, relationships with the community and innovative facilities like WiFi and USB charging points.
In a double-win for the company at the glitzy Birmingham awards bash, Andrew Wickham, Go South Coast's managing director, picked up the Manager of the Year gong.
“I am tremendously proud of our achievements - and they are in no small part due to the efforts of Thamesdown in Swindon,” said Andrew. “I am lucky enough to work with wonderful people here, and I’m delighted for the entire team.
“This group of experienced and highly skilled professionals provides our customers with an excellent service, transporting them across the island with the minimum of fuss. This is just reward for all their efforts.
“I’d like to congratulate all those who have contributed to an incredibly successful year.”
